Procedural law refers to:
a. laws proscribing criminal behavior.
b. laws delineating the legal methods to be used when enforcing the rights and duties of persons toward each other.
c. statutes passed by legislative bodies of government.
d. English customs, rules, and traditions.
e. none of the above.
Answer: b
